gpt4 book ai didi

ffmpeg - 生成包含滚动图像的视频

转载 作者:行者123 更新时间:2023-12-04 21:33:04 26 4
gpt4 key购买 nike

我想从 800x10000 的静止图像生成视频 [比如说 800x600]。

图像必须从上到下滚动,就好像有人在滚动页面一样。

如果它可以在某些部分上滚动得更快而在其他部分上滚动得更慢,那就太好了,否则我想我可以制作几个单独的视频,然后将它们拼接起来。

我找不到有关此主题的任何文档;谁能给我一个提示?感谢您的宝贵时间!

最佳答案

使用 scroll筛选。 crop过滤器是可选的,将为大图像输入输出合理的宽度和高度。您可以考虑使用 scale也过滤。 format过滤器输出广泛兼容的像素格式/色度子采样方案。

垂直

ffmpeg -loop 1 -i input.png -vf "scroll=vertical=0.01,crop=iw:600:0:0,format=yuv420p" -t 10 output.mp4

水平的

ffmpeg -loop 1 -i input.png -vf "scroll=horizontal=0.01,crop=800:600:0:0,format=yuv420p" -t 10 output.mp4

滚动过滤器选项

  • horizo​​ntal, h 设置水平滚动速度。默认值为 0。允许的范围是 -1 到 1。负值更改滚动方向。

  • vertical, v 设置垂直滚动速度。默认值为 0。允许的范围是 -1 到 1。负值更改滚动方向。

  • hpos 设置初始水平滚动位置。默认值为 0。允许的范围是 0 到 1。

  • vpos 设置初始垂直滚动位置。默认值为 0。允许的范围是 0 到 1。

关于ffmpeg - 生成包含滚动图像的视频,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/24316446/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com